Historically, Indian cinema often sidelined leading actresses after marriage or childbirth. Kapoor aggressively dismantled this norm. She worked through both of her pregnancies, proudly flaunting her baby bump in high-fashion media campaigns and film shoots. 2. The Paparazzi and Social Media Economy

In the vast landscape of global popular media, few figures have commanded the spotlight as long or as dynamically as Kareena Kapoor Khan. Over a career spanning more than two decades, Kapoor has evolved from a third-generation Bollywood legacy actress into a definitive cultural icon. Her influence extends far beyond traditional cinema screens, permeating digital streaming platforms, reality television, podcasting, and social media. As a central subject of entertainment content, Kareena Kapoor serves as a case study for how modern celebrity culture interacts with audience consumption patterns, shifting feminist narratives, and contemporary media formats.
